Cohiba: Cuba’s Crown Jewel

Brand History

Cohiba cigarillos are likely the most respected and famed Cuban stogies, reaching their roots to 1966. At first allocated as a official token for Fidel Castro and international dignitaries, these cigarillos became readily available in 1982. The name "Cohiba" comes from the historic Taíno word for tobacco, accentuating the deep historical tie between Cuba and top-grade cigar culture. Today, two forms of the maker remain: Cuban Cohiba, made solely by the Cuban state-owned company Habanos S.A., and Dominican Cohiba, manufactured for overseas markets by General Cigar Company due to the U.S. embargo on Cuban goods.

Signature Products

Cohiba Behike 56

Considered one of the most opulent cigarillos in the realm, the Behike line presents rare medio tiempo leaves, which give sophistication and vigor. The 56 is recognized for its mellow yet bold profile, providing hints of cocoa, cedar, and leather.

Cohiba Robusto

A robust and even timeless, this cigarillo imparts a coordinated fusion of spice, cream, and earthiness. It is a superb starting point to the maker's lineup.

Cohiba Siglo VI

This cigarillo offers a balanced smoke with hints of citrus, honey, and vanilla, making it a favorite among knowledgeable smokers.

Why Cohiba Stands Out

Cohiba rolls are expertly rolled with the top quality Cuban tobacco. Their manufacturing involves an extra fermentation method, bestowing the smokes unmatched mellowness and finesse. Whether in their Cuban or non-Cuban variant, Cohibas hold an aura of prestige, esteemed by cigar aficionados throughout the world.

Montecristo: A Timeless Classic

Brand History

Montecristo was started in 1935 in Cuba by Alonso Menéndez, named after Alexandre Dumas' novel The Count of Monte Cristo, which was a favored book among the assembly workers. Like Cohiba, the Montecristo name has dual identities: Habanos S.A. controls Cuban Montecristo smokes, while Altadis U.S.A. develops the Dominican version for global markets. Montecristo cigars have become some of the most renowned luxury smokes due to their spotless craftsmanship and balanced flavor palettes.

Signature Products

Montecristo No. 2

Generally seen as one of the finest rolls ever made, this torpedo-shaped stogie presents a smooth, medium-bodied smoke with undertones of coffee, spice, and leather.

Montecristo White Series No. 2

A Dominican-made version of the No. 2, it incorporates a Connecticut Shade wrapper and provides a gentler, creamy indulgence with notes of almonds and vanilla.

Montecristo 1935 Anniversary Nicaragua Toro

A powerful tribute to the brand’s heritage, this Nicaraguan puro highlights a rich palette with flavors of cocoa, pepper, and dried fruit.

Why Montecristo Stands Out

Montecristo’s capacity to entice to both entry-level smokers and seasoned connoisseurs renders it singular. Its rolls are noted for balance and uniformity, turning them a go-to exclusive maker for those wanting a refined yet approachable smoke.

Davidoff: Elegance from the Heart of Switzerland

Brand History

Davidoff, created by Zino Davidoff, has its roots in Switzerland and commenced as a high-end tobacco shop in Geneva in 1911. In the 1940s, Zino Davidoff teamed up with Cuban cigarillo makers to begin his distinctive line. However, in the 1980s, Davidoff shifted production to the Dominican Republic, where it remains to manufacture some of the finest non-Cuban smokes. The label highlights elegance, consistency, and innovation, with every cigar meticulously crafted to impart a lavish smoking experience.

Signature Products

Davidoff Signature No. 2

Renowned for its creamy and smooth flavor, this elegant cigar yields touches of cedar, white pepper, and floral tones, rendering it a spot-on morning or afternoon smoke.

Davidoff Winston Churchill The Late Hour

Driven by the legendary British statesman, this medium-full smoke uses tobacco aged in Scotch whisky barrels, offering a bold and rich character with hints of dark chocolate, oak, and spice.

Davidoff Nicaragua Toro

A move from the company's traditional Dominican focus, this Nicaraguan cigar gives a full-bodied draw with peppery nuances, coffee, and dark fruit.

Why Davidoff Stands Out

Davidoff cigarillos epitomize sophistication and luxury. The company prides itself on innovation, venturing with mixtures from multiple countries, including Nicaragua and Brazil, while sustaining its Dominican core. The elegant aesthetic, immaculate construction, and unique flavor nuances render Davidoff a representation of refinement.

Cuban vs. Non-Cuban Luxury Cigars: A Comparative Analysis

Introduction

The debate between Cuban and non-Cuban luxury cigars has captivated aficionados and casual smokers united for many years. Cuban cigars have long been deemed the epitome of mastery, but over the years, non-Cuban brands have surfaced to contest that supremacy. This article supplies a extensive evaluation of taste, construction, and esteem between Cuban and non-Cuban cigars, in addition to a consideration of legal aspects and provision in universal markets.

Distinctions in Bouquet Notes
Cuban Cigars

Cuban cigars are famous for their individual savor, often characterized as musky, velvety, and uniform. The unique aroma is attributed to Cuba's land—the rich soil and conducive weather existing especially in the Vuelta Abajo and Pinar del Río regions, where first-rate tobacco is cultivated.

Common Flavor Notes: Cedar, earth, leather, and whispers of spice.

Famous Cuban Brands: Cohiba, Montecristo, Partagás, Romeo y Julieta.

Cuban cigars often feature a intermediate to strong intensity, developing throughout the draw with levels of intricacy. Many devotees admire their silky yet assertive closure, achieved through Cuba’s time-honored processing and refining methods.

Non-Cuban Cigars

Non-Cuban cigars, manufactured across countries like the Dominican Republic, Nicaragua, Honduras, and elsewhere, supply a far more diverse range of tastes. Each region’s individual soil and horticultural conditions give rise to various profiles.

Dominican Republic: Known for gentle, delicate to mid-strength cigars with aromatic and earthy notes.

Nicaragua: Esteemed for potent, seasoned cigars with profound bouquets of cocoa, coffee, and pepper.

Honduras: Known for hearty cigars with musky and textured undertones.

Non-Cuban cigars have also become a platform for fusion—allowing companies to test with tobaccos from several countries to attain intricate flavor melds.

Conclusion on Flavor

While Cuban cigars copyright a certain enigma with their characteristic creaminess, non-Cuban cigars can offer wider array in aroma and potency. Some smokers lean towards Cuban cigars for page their heritage, tried-and-true characteristics, while others lean towards the cutting-edge appeal that non-Cuban blends deliver.

Craftsmanship and Quality Control
Cuban Cigars

The construction of Cuban cigars is often upheld to elevated standards, with each product being artisan-crafted by experienced torcedores (cigar rollers). However, some devotees claim that quality control difficulties have emerged in recent years, chiefly due to heightened production expectations to satisfy international interest. Occasional difficulties such as uneven smoke or rigid pulls can reduce from the smoke. Still, when appropriately assembled, Cuban cigars are celebrated for their graceful fabrication, unobstructed pull, and reliable residue.

Non-Cuban Cigars

Non-Cuban producers have put heavily in up-to-date quality control operations to maintain uniformity, yielding in some of the most steady luxury cigars provided. Countries like Nicaragua and the Dominican Republic have also cultivated highly skilled rollers, guaranteeing outstanding mastery across various top-quality brands.

Non-Cuban cigars often showcase advanced cap toppings for improved robustness and display.

The use of entire leaf filler tobaccos in most non-Cuban luxury cigars causes to their first-rate suction and prolonged ignition.

Some cigar devotees contend that non-Cuban brands present higher uniformity in construction, often outpacing Cuban cigars in this respect.

Stature and Prestige
Cuban Cigars: Legendary Status

The renown of Cuban cigars is immersed in history and mystique. For many, Cuban cigars signify the zenith of luxury, partly because of the prohibition imposed by the United States in 1962. This blockade established an air of elitism, making Cuban cigars the quintessential status emblem among cigar enthusiasts.

The most acclaimed Cuban brands, like Cohiba and Montecristo, are associated with luxury. Cohibas, in particular, were in the beginning crafted for Fidel Castro and given as offerings to foreign representatives, further elevating their prestige.

Non-Cuban Cigars: A Rising Challenger

In recent eras, non-Cuban cigars have gained significant admiration. Nicaragua, in particular, has surfaced as a dominant force of high-end cigars, with brands like Padron and Drew Estate opposing or even surpassing their Cuban peers in some sectors. The Dominican Republic has also produced top-tier cigars like the Arturo Fuente Opus X, cementing its spot among top-tier luxury cigar makers.

Today, many cigar lovers appreciate that non-Cuban cigars can match or surpass the caliber and essence of Cuban cigars, especially given the range and originality in amalgamation approaches.

Legal Aspects and Availability
Cuban Cigars: Restrictions and Challenges

For decades, Cuban cigars were prohibited in the United States due to the trade ban. Though voyagers can now convey minimal batches of Cuban cigars into the U.S. for non-commercial use, commercial sales are still not allowed, restricting accessibility. In other parts of the world, Cuban cigars are readily in stock but often enter with premium prices and finite supply due to demand.

Additionally, knockoff Cuban cigars are an relentless issue. Frauds, often i thought about this hawked in tourist-laden areas, can make it problematic for non-regular buyers to confirm they are buying authentic Cuban commodities.

Non-Cuban Cigars: Unrestricted Access

Non-Cuban luxury cigars are widely accessible in the U.S. and around the world, making them much easier to procure than their Cuban opponents. The worldwide market for non-Cuban cigars has flourished, supplying cigar aficionados admission to top-quality brands from Nicaragua, the Dominican Republic, Honduras, and more.

Because non-Cuban brands confront fewer barriers, they can interact in unrestricted competition through value, distribution, and branding. Additionally, non-Cuban producers often accommodate to U.S. buyers, certifying that their items serve the tastes and wants of one of the world’s largest luxury cigar markets.
